WebI’m an award-winning User Experience (UX) Leader with over 20 years of experience helping leading organisations meet the evolving needs of … WebFeb 14, 2024 · The First Nations Peoples Strategic Advisory Group (FNPSAG) has been set up to support the Royal Commission in its work by providing leadership and guidance on matters specific to First Nations … WebNov 18, 2024 · 18 November 2024 First Nations Australians living with disability are accessing the NDIS in greater numbers, according to new data. The latest NDIS Quarterly Report shows that of the 23,137 new participants to enter the Scheme in the quarter, 9.4 per cent (2,169) identified as First Nations peoples. how to sign up for obamacare in new jersey

WebRisk reduction. The FPDN is a national peak organisation who represent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people with disability and their families and aim to be a strong voice of and for them. FPDN do this using a range of strategies including providing advice to government and educating the government and non-government sectors about how ...
